Christie

by Erin L George


C herry lips hinting of lime

h ug tight at her chest

r uby dressed. And I?

i try not to stare, and ask:

s weet Valentine, may I

t aste you?

I know no other way to quench our thirsts,

e ntwined by kisses...


L et me look at you,

y our heart-shaped smile

n ever less than amazing -

n ymph of all things woman.


T asty

a ugust sunshine, may I bask in

y our smell, sweet like summer

l emonade. Sugar n spice, all things fine -

o h! How I want to know you

r uby red lacing my mind.

© 2010 Erin Lee
